What Payroll Management Means
Payroll management is the process of handling employee compensation accurately and consistently. It covers salaries, allowances, deductions, overtime, tax withholding, attendance adjustments, bonuses, and payroll reporting. In practical terms, it ensures every employee receives the correct payment at the correct time while the business keeps accurate payroll records.
At first glance, that may sound straightforward. But payroll often becomes more complicated as businesses expand. A company with five employees can often manage salaries manually. A company with twenty, fifty, or one hundred employees starts dealing with multiple payroll variables every month. Different departments, different salary packages, leave deductions, tax calculations, reimbursements, and employee benefits all enter the picture.
Payroll also touches trust. Employees expect salary accuracy because payroll directly affects daily life. A payroll mistake can feel bigger than a simple accounting error. It affects morale, creates unnecessary questions, and increases internal workload. Strong payroll systems protect both financial operations and employee confidence.

Payroll Challenges Businesses Face in Pakistan
Many businesses in Pakistan begin payroll manually using spreadsheets or internal accounting teams. That may work initially, but growth often exposes weaknesses.
Manual Errors
A small formula error can affect salaries, deductions, and reporting.
Common mistakes include:
- Wrong allowances
- Duplicate entries
- Incorrect leave deductions
- Payroll mismatches
Tax and Compliance Issues
Payroll often links directly with:
- Income tax deduction
- Employee tax records
- Financial documentation
Mistakes create compliance risk.
Delayed Salary Processing
Employees expect timely payments.
Delays can happen because of:
- Manual approvals
- Poor recordkeeping
- Missing attendance updates
A late payroll cycle often creates avoidable internal stress.
